Hmm, your problem is that program itself. As I said, sometimes the "antivirus programs" are actually spyware in disguise. You need to hit "CTRL + ALT + DEL" and check all the programs that are running. If the program is sending the adds it'self, it may be opened in the panel, just simply [ Right click it - Properties - Open file location- and uninstall it] Or go to [ Control Panel "in your start up menu" - Programs "if using vista like me, you will need to hit Control panel home and it will be there" - Uninstall a program] But yeah, if that doesn't fix it, use that "Startup control panel program" I mentioned in previous posts and that should do it.
